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Chinor.
- Try the plov; it's one of their signature dishes and highly recommended by locals.
- Visit during lunch hours for special midday deals.
- Don't miss out on trying their homemade bread; it's freshly baked daily.
- Make reservations if you're visiting on weekends as it can get quite busy.
